Maailie - If you don't do lites, you get moved to the next plan. Red comes after purple, so you got the right plan. She crossed out the lites because they don't have a separate plan book for no lites. If you do the lites, you move down to purple. You can always start with lites and drop them, or add lites later, but you can't have a day with lites and then a day without. You need to choose one plan and go with it.
That being said, I do the lites because I enjoy the taste, and they are a nice treat. But there are plenty of girls on the board who don't do them and who have had great success.
